The Illusion of Intelligence: Deconstructing the Myth of AI Consciousness

In the autumn of 2021, a significant controversy erupted at Google headquarters when software engineer Blake Lemoine publicly claimed that "Lambda," an artificial intelligence chatbot, had achieved a state of consciousness. Lemoine argued that the machine was not merely a program, but an intelligent "person" with "wishes and rights" that required human respect. This incident ignited a global debate regarding whether AI is truly capable of internal experience or if we are simply falling for a sophisticated illusion.

The Linguistic Trap: Misleading Terminology

Professor Emily Bender, a leading expert in linguistics and computing at the University of Washington, challenges the notion that AI is as intelligent as it appears. She suggests that our modern lexicon regarding technology is fundamentally flawed. Terms like "machine learning" or "speech recognition" imbue computers with human-like capabilities they do not possess.

Bender highlights that "recognition" implies "cognitive" processes—actions related to "thinking, knowing, learning and understanding." She argues that these are strictly "human, not machine, activities." Instead, she proposes that terms like "automatic transcription" would be more accurate, as they simply describe an "input-output relation" without indulging in "wishful thinking"—the dangerous tendency to believe that something unlikely will occur simply because we desire it.

Technical Bias and Anthropomorphism

This linguistic framing contributes to what Professor Bender defines as "technical bias": the erroneous assumption that a computer is an infallible, objective authority. Because AI is trained to generate natural-sounding language by "finding patterns in massive amounts of data," humans are naturally predisposed to project a consciousness onto the machine.

Bender explains this phenomenon as "anthropomorphising" computers. The term derives from "anthro" (human) and "morph" (shape), meaning we effectively "put the shape of a human on something" that is inherently non-human. We are so hardwired to see ourselves in the world around us that we treat algorithms like people, much as we might assign personalities to dolls or action figures.

The Risks of Being Taken In

The danger of anthropomorphism is that it leaves humans vulnerable to being "blindsided"—a state of being "surprised in a negative way." As AI systems become more proficient at mimicking human discourse, the risk of being "taken in" increases. When a machine is "fluent" enough to converse on diverse topics, users are easily "tricked or deceived" into believing they are dealing with a sentient entity rather than a complex statistical model.

Conclusion: The Reality of AI

While science fiction, such as the 2013 film Her, explores the idea of humans forming deep, emotional bonds with computers, the reality is far more clinical. Current AI technology, including advanced chatbots, operates solely on data analysis. While these machines can "appear conscious" through their ability to simulate human-like interaction, they remain years—if not decades—away from possessing genuine internal states like dreaming or falling in love. Understanding this distinction is vital to ensure we remain the masters of our tools rather than becoming victims of our own projected illusions.
